Hello,
I was wondering if you all think this lighting would be sufficient for sps corals?
8x 64 watt compact fluorescents, half actinic
Thanks
 
Nope CF(compact fluorescent) isn't powerful enough for SPS. I had the config you described, 8x 64w, and it couldn't keep montipora alive 4" from the surface. The issue is that they don't penetrate and there's alot of lost light. If you want to do SPS, your options are basically T5 with good reflectors, metal halides, or LEDs which is what I'm using now. I have a 100 gal, running 60w of Cree LEDs on half the tank and I'm keeping montipora, stylo, and acro. They've colored up noticeably since I bought them. They were under metal halides at the store.
 
If the tank is shallow i woudnt see a problem, but they dont have good par, and bulb life sucks. If you want great light look int MH or T5. I only use Pc for supplement for my MH becouse they dont make a 15" T5 bulb. HTH
